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Обновление сводных таблиц через odbc. excel 2007. odbc-коннект к oracle. / 4 сообщений из 4, страница 1 из 1
15.06.2010, 00:05
    #36686711
gatogordo
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Обновление сводных таблиц через odbc. excel 2007. odbc-коннект к oracle.
Добрый день.
Вопрос:
как обновить сводные таблицы в файле excel, чтобы в connection string не оставался пароль подключения?
Выглядит процесс так: макрос из первой книги запускает вторую книгу, в которой сохранены отчеты в виде сводных таблиц, потом запускает refreshall.
Но чтобы это сработало, нужно, чтобы во второй книге в строке подключения сводной таблицы хранился пароль.
Как сделать так, чтобы пароль не сохранялся во второй книге, а указывался где нибудь в первой книге?
Спасибо.
...
Рейтинг: 0 / 0
15.06.2010, 10:04
    #36686994
big-duke
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Обновление сводных таблиц через odbc. excel 2007. odbc-коннект к oracle.
gatogordo,
А оракл поддерживает доменную аутентификацию ?
...
Рейтинг: 0 / 0
16.06.2010, 12:21
    #36689651
gatogordo
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Обновление сводных таблиц через odbc. excel 2007. odbc-коннект к oracle.
big-duke,
нет, идентификация через логин/пароль.
...
Рейтинг: 0 / 0
16.06.2010, 14:17
    #36690048
Shamanus
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Обновление сводных таблиц через odbc. excel 2007. odbc-коннект к oracle.
gatogordo,

а если сделать так, первой книге сделать подключение без указания пароля

будет строка вида

Код: plaintext
1.
2.
ActiveSheet.ListObjects.Add(SourceType:= 0 , Source:=Array(Array( _
        "ODBC;DSN=Oracle;UID=USER;;DBQ=DWH ;DBA=R;APA=T;EXC=F;XSM=Database;FEN=T;QTO=F;FRC=10;FDL=10;LOB=T;RST=T;BTD=F;BNF=F;BAM=IfAllSucc" _
        ), Array("essful;NUM=NLS;DPM=F;MTS=T;MDI=F;CSR=F;FWC=F;FBS=64000;TLO=O;"))e

ну не такая конечно, но примерно.

во второй книге при открытии первой корректировать параметры подключения (где в строке пассворд будет пароль), а потом после рефреша менять параметры подключения на прежние, т.е. таже строка но с полем пассворд пустым


правда тогда косяк, рефрешить сможет только вторая книга
...
Рейтинг: 0 / 0
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Обновление сводных таблиц через odbc. excel 2007. odbc-коннект к oracle. / 4 сообщений из 4,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]